As NFL free agency approaches, Ben Solak examines nine critical questions facing teams, with Kyler Murray's landing spot topping the list. The former Cardinals quarterback faces an unusual situation after being cut with $36.8 million in guaranteed money remaining, which will follow him to his next team through offset language.

Murray's financial flexibility removes the typical contract considerations from his decision, making him a fascinating free agent. The Minnesota Vikings emerge as a potential destination under head coach Kevin O'Connell, who has a track record of quarterback development with Kirk Cousins and Sam Darnold. However, Minnesota's cap-strapped situation complicates matters, as the team is reportedly $45 million over the salary cap ceiling and must shed veteran contracts including Ryan Kelly, Javon Hargrave, and Jonathan Allen.

Other pressing questions include the future of A.J. Brown and whether offensive linemen will command big money in this $300 million salary cap environment. With 32 fan bases eagerly anticipating moves, Solak suggests Murray's decision will be particularly challenging given that every potential landing spot presents both enticing opportunities and significant drawbacks.
